2015 - James Baker's last-gasp try set up a thrilling 31-30 win for Rams against Coventry-based visitors Broadstreet in their last pre-season friendly.
Tight-head Baker, corner-stone of a strong Rams scrum, touched down after Samir Kharbouch's clean take from a short-yardage line-out.
This victory over a fellow National Two side shows the Sonning men can go into next Saturday's league opener against Redruth with plenty of confidence.
Rams coach Mike Tewkesbury admitted: "I was pleased with the performance. However, we also learned mistakes will be punished at this level."
"But we showed great resilience and effort and the hard work of the lads during the summer showed through."
Rams' 12-10 interval lead was scant reward after controlling most of the first half.
Azza Hopkins and Sean McDermottroe touched down, but Broadstreet spread the ball wide twice to score against the run of play.
Straight from the restart, Luke Flower's crosskick set up a try for Dan Barnes, who along with centre partner Steve Bryant, looked dynamic in attack and defence. Flower added his second conversion.
However the Coventry men dominated most of the second period and added 17 points despite Rams' gritty defence.
It looked bleak for them at 27-19 down in the closing stages but winger McDermottroe showed his great strength and pace to finish off a backs move.
And Guy Swadling added a touchline conversion before Baker grabbed the vital points.
